Maharashtra: Assistant Public Prosecutor held on graft charge

Nashik: An Assistant Public Prosecutor was arrested for allegedly taking bribe in lieu of having got her client acquitted in a case by Anti-Corruption Bureau (ACB) officials in Niphad taluka of the district, police said.


The accused, identified as Jyoti Tukaram Nirgude, who had appeared for her client in a court case, had demanded Rs 5,000 from him after the latter was acquitted, an ACB press release said.


The bribe amount was settled at Rs 1,500, following which her client approached the ACB, it said. ACB sleuths laid a trap and caught the accused red-handed while accepting the bribe in Niphad court premises on Thursday, it said.


A case has been registered in this connection and further investigation is on, the release said.
